The Community Health Worker- BH works to locate, engage, and educate members referred to AbsoluteCare by their health plan.  Establish trust and build meaningful relationships with members.  Promote AbsoluteCare medical center as the “Go-To” resource for our members instead of using the emergency room or other fragmented higher cost medical resources.  This role helps improve access to health care services, increasing health and screening, enhancing communication between community members and health providers, and reducing the need for emergency and specialty services.  Locate, engage, and educate member on AbsoluteCare’s services.  Explain AbsoluteCare’s model of care and the benefits to the member if choosing AbsoluteCare as primary care provider (PCP). Provide home visits to members.

At AbsoluteCare, we serve the most vulnerable individuals in America. These are our neighbors, people who are at higher risk for disease or who have multiple, complex, chronic illnesses. Often, they deal with an unequal healthcare system and wind up seeking basic care from emergency rooms. We take these patients out of those spaces and turn them into members: people who are entitled to some of the best, most focused care this country has to offer. 

We call this “care beyond medicine.” We have turned the doctor’s office into a comprehensive care center. Here, we surround our members with a core care team of doctors, nurses, social workers, and medical assistants who have the time and skills to get to know our members’ needs. We make the most important services available to our members under one roof. This includes a pharmacy, X-rays, a blood lab, nutrition services, urgent care, and much more.

We don’t stop at our four walls. We engage members in the communities where we all live to find the people who need us most. Through these community care teams, we remove the barriers to healthcare that so many people face daily. And it works
